How to Design Infrastructure That Withstands Extreme Weather Events"
Extreme weather events, such as hurricanes, floods, and heatwaves, are becoming increasingly common due to climate change. These events can cause significant damage to infrastructure, disrupting essential services and endangering lives. In order to mitigate the impact of extreme weather events, it is crucial to design infrastructure that is resilient and can withstand these challenges. This article will explore some key considerations and strategies for designing infrastructure that can withstand extreme weather events.
Understanding the Risks
The first step in designing resilient infrastructure is to understand the specific risks posed by extreme weather events in a particular region. This requires conducting a thorough analysis of historical weather data, as well as projections for future climate conditions. By understanding the risks, engineers and planners can make informed decisions about the design and location of infrastructure projects. Adapting to Climate Change
Climate change is causing shifts in weather patterns, making extreme weather events more frequent and intense. In order to design infrastructure that can withstand these changes, it is important to take into account future climate projections. This may involve incorporating flexible design features that can adapt to changing conditions, such as elevated buildings to mitigate flooding or green roofs to reduce urban heat island effect.
